The very last decision in Life is Strange forces players to save Chloe or Arcadia Bay. It’s the biggest choice in the entire game, and as such, has the biggest consequences attached to it.

It’s impossible to talk about the consequences of choosing to save Chloe or Arcadia Bay without revealing the two different endings, so be warned that the following guide contains major spoilers for the closing moments of Life is Strange.

Consequences of Saving Arcadia Bay in Life is Strange

If Chloe is sacrificed to save Arcadia Bay from the oncoming tornado, Max will use the butterfly photo to travel back to the moment Nathan shot Chloe in Episode 1 of Life is Strange. Instead of stopping him, she will not intervene, and Chloe will die. This stops the tornado from forming, and Arcadia Bay and its residents will be safe.

Depending on players' decisions throughout the game, like whether Max blamed Chloe or took the blame in Episode 1, the pair will either hug or share a kiss before Max travels back in time. To get the pair to kiss, players should side with Chloe and show concern for her money trouble and safety throughout the game.

If Arcadia Bay is saved, the closing moments of the game show every major character attending Chloe's funeral. Mr. Jefferson will of course be absent, as he has presumably been apprehended by the police already.

Consequences of Saving Chloe in Life is Strange

If Arcadia Bay is sacrificed to save Chloe instead, Max will rip the butterfly picture and throw it into the storm. This is a much shorter ending to Max's story in Life is Strange, and players don't know who survived the tornado as the camera pans over the huge wreckage from the storm.

Max and Chloe will not kiss during this ending, but they do share a hug while looking at the oncoming storm. At the very end, the pair is shown driving out of Arcadia Bay in Chloe's car.

Should You Save Chloe or Arcadia Bay?

This is the most important choice in Life is Strange, but the only correct option is to pick whichever ending players feel is right. Although sacrificing the whole of Arcadia Bay just for Chloe might seem like the "bad" ending, Episode 5 makes a compelling case for why both options are viable.

The entire game has focused on Max and Chloe's rekindled relationship. Still, there are also a lot of moments with many other characters from Arcadia Bay and the Blackwell Academy students to consider when choosing between saving Chloe or Arcadia Bay.

There is no true sequel to the first season's events, and no canon ending. So players are left to choose whatever option feels best to them.
